directions

  • Preheat the oven to 325 degrees F. Toss the chocolate and butter into a small bowl and set over a small pot of simmering water to begin melting it. This will insulate the delicate chocolate from direct heat and keep it from scorching. As they begin to melt stir until smooth then remove them from the heat.
  • Whisk the eggs, sugar, vanilla and coffee together. Add the chocolate mixture, whisk until smooth then divide evenly between four coffee mugs.
  • Place the mugs in a small high-sided pot. Add enough hot water around the cups to equal the level of the batter within the cups. Bake until the custards are set, about 45 minutes. Check their doneness by jiggling them slightly. They should appear to be set but still have a bit of a quiver in the center. You may also insert a toothpick to judge doneness. They may take as long as 60 minutes but no longer.
